"So you're inviting Hanako Arasaka to the Christmas party, huh?"

Oliver, driving the car, wasn't particularly surprised. He just turned to Jackie in the passenger seat and said, "Guess we'll need to set another place at the table. Not sure she's the type who's into street food though."

"I wouldn't worry about it," V chimed in from the backseat. "Mrs. Wells' cooking is the best I've ever had. As long as she's making the food, there won't be a problem. Didn't you guys tell me back when Karl first got to Night City, he couldn't stomach anything—except Mrs. Wells' fries?"

"Yeah," Jackie snorted. "Dude was practically hugging the fry bucket at home. I'm pretty sure he ate more fries in those weeks than I did in a year."

"What's the saying again?" Jackie grinned. "Starving ghost reborn?"

"Bullshit," Karl rolled his eyes. "They were just good fries. I wasn't shoveling them down like an animal."

Nobody in the crew seemed shocked about Hanako coming. There was no fuss, no fanfare. When Karl mentioned he'd invited her, everyone just gave a casual "oh" and started prepping an extra set of utensils.

A year ago? That would've been impossible. Back then, they were nobodies—street kids and Badlands drifters. They didn't know Hanako, and even if they did, they wouldn't have trusted anyone from Arasaka. But now?

Hell, even Saisen Arasaka had sat down and shared drinks and hotpot with them. No matter how high up Hanako was, she didn't outrank Saisen inside Arasaka. Besides, she was Karl's friend. That was all that mattered.

Then Jackie remembered something. "Wait—what about that bodyguard chick who's always glued to her? If she's coming too, that's one more seat."

"The bar's got enough spare plates," Oliver shrugged. "No shortage there." He paused. "Hey, what about Kenichiro? He coming?"

To the squad, Kenichiro was a pretty unique figure. Each of them had an Arasaka identity on paper tied to his name. Most of their Arasaka jobs came through him. He was the Arasaka rep they were closest to. If he was coming, yeah—they'd need to go all out.

"I didn't invite him," Karl said honestly. "He's been swamped. No need to bug him. But maybe we can check if Mr. Johnson and Andy are free this year. Last time, they couldn't take time off—too many arrests piling up during the holidays. This year's been a little quieter on the streets. They might have room to breathe."

"Mr. Johnson, huh…" Jackie's mind wandered. "Oh crap, almost forgot—Oliver, think your old man and your sister can make it? And what about Jade, that guy from the distribution center who keeps bringing us meat? We've gotten drunk with him like a dozen times. He in?"

"I'll check with them later," Oliver muttered. "But damn, that's already a lot of people. Think El Coyote Cojo can fit us all?"

"If not," V offered, "we host it at our place. It's big enough. We can ask Mrs. Wells and Misty to come early and decorate the way they like. Oh, and I haven't told Vik yet—gotta hit him up."

"Hosting it at home sounds good," Jackie nodded. "I'll let Mom know. Oh, and we should check in with Brown and Maine's crew too. Don't know if they've got the time, but it's worth asking."

"Brown's probably still guarding Kerry," Jackie added. "No idea if he can sneak away."

"Then bring Kerry along too," V said casually. "He's chill. Back when he was in Night City, we used to hang out, drink, talk about music."

V had bonded with Kerry after hearing him perform live back in Dogtown. He'd even visited him a few times after that. To him, Kerry was a choomba. And choombas? Always welcome.

"Damn," Oliver laughed. "We're talking rockstar Kerry, my old man, Johnson… This party's sounding flashier than anything over in Corpo Plaza."

He started doing a mental headcount. "We're gonna need a bigger cake."

"No need to order one," Karl said, shaking his head. "I'll bake it. Kenichiro sent me some premium flour not long ago. Might as well put it to use."

"So… he sent ingredients, and we're not inviting him?" V raised an eyebrow. "Kinda messed up. Maybe just ask?"

Karl hesitated… then gave in and sent a message.

Kenichiro: "Busy. Can't make it. Don't try the guilt card."

Karl: "?"

He stared at the blunt response. "He turned me down."

"Cool, no reason to feel bad then," Oliver shrugged. "Oh, by the way—should we invite Blanca? She's been one of our longest-running clients. Sure, she mostly deals with you, Karl, but we're inviting a lot of folks who only know one of us anyway. So…?"

"Then I gotta invite someone else too," Karl replied, thinking of Maki. He hadn't even messaged her yet when—

Maki: "Do you like cake? Christmas is coming. I'm baking a big one. Let's go eat it at Hanako's place."

Still sharp as ever. She always beat him to the punch.

Karl: "Come to my place instead. Hanako too."

He sent her the message, then Blanca's reply finally came in.

Blanca: "Where?"

Karl: "My place."

There was a long pause. Karl figured she was busy with work again, maybe stuck in overtime.

Then finally—

Blanca: "好."

Just one simple character. "Okay."
